If your looking at wifi audio systems for your home then the Philips WACS7000 wireless music system could be the solution for you.

With a 80GB hard disk inside you can rip your CD collection in a variety of MP3 bit rates. You can also make use of your PC if you have a large collection of music on it, either by copying the files directly on to the system’s internal disk or by hooking it up to your home network (wired or wireless). Philips provides a really simple and foolproof application to set your computer up as a media server.

New Toshiba G910 Portege Handset

February 4, 2008 at 1:30 pm

 Toshiba’s new Portege G910 arrving shortly comes with Windows 6 and built in GPS (that supports Qualcomm’s gpsOneXTRA Assistance Technology) and biometric reader.

 Portege G910

Portege G910

• Size: 145cc, 117mm x 64mm x 19.8mm
• Weight: 183g
• Camera: 2 mega pixel VGA camera, 2nd camera for video calling
• Memory: ROM 256MB, RAM 128MB
• Interface: Bluetooth™ 2.0, USB, WiFi
• Band: 2100 HSDPA, 900/1800/1900 GSM/EDGE, GPRS class 10
• Navigation: Built-in GPS
• Standby: Up to 460hrs*
• Talktime: Up to 300mins*
• Display: Wide-VGA (480×800), 65k colours, TFT 3.0”
• Messaging: SMS, MMS, E-mail, Wireless push e-mail, Windows Live Messenger
• Media Player: MP3, AAC, AAC+, eAAC+, WMA
• Music Service: Windows Media Player
• Security: Fingerprint authentication
• VoIP: Over WiFi
• Java: MIDP2.0, JSR179
• PIM/sync: Mobile Outlook (address book, Calender) / ActiveSync (Address book, Calender, Mail, folder)
• Accessories: USB cable, Stereo headset (with microphone), charger, user guide, CD-ROMAvailable 1st Quarter 2008

New Nokia N810 Internet Tablet

January 17, 2008 at 8:06 am

Nokia’s new Linux based tablet allows users to connect to the internet with ease. The N810 will be the first device to use the Nokia Internet Tablet OS 2008. The new OS has a Mozilla Gecko based browser, 2Gb of internal storage, 0.3 MP camera and a MiniSDHC card slot. It also has a transreflective display which allows the user to read even in bright sunlight.

Nokia N810

  • Display: High-resolution 4.13-inch WVGA display (800 x 480 pixels) with up to 65,000 colors
  • Connectivity: GPS, Bluetooth, WiFi, USB
  • Battery Life: 4 hours (Browsing), 14 days (Standby)
  • Dimensions: 226 x 72 x 128mm
  • Weight: 226g

World’s smallest x86-based Internet tablet?

January 15, 2008 at 10:00 am

Chipmaker Via & its sponsor have created the 3.3-inch square “MTube” the “world’s smallest x86 PC,” and the first “IMP” (Internet Media Player) with TV recording capabilities. The 5.3-ounce MTube measures 3.3 x 3.3 x 0.8 inches (8.3 x 8.3 x 2cm), and sports a 2.8-inch VGA (640 x 480) touch panel display. There’s built-in WiFi and WiMax wireless communications, with CDMA cellular networking optional.

World’s smallest x86-based Internet tablet?

 

The MTube was shown decoding a simulated digital TV (DVB-T) broadcast. It was also shown streaming video to a wirelessly connected digital photo frame. Advanced digital TV features reportedly include time-shifted TV viewing, via 8GB of built-in flash, and picture-in-picture viewing. There’s also a full browser (mostlikely Firefox) supporting “Web 2.0″ content. Via’s demo of the device featured YouTube video content and Google Maps.

Nyko Zero Wireless PS3 Controller

January 11, 2008 at 3:30 pm

This sleek WiFi controller from Nyko is compatible with all PS3 software & controls. It is constructed from aluminum (to help with heat dissipating) and a combination of metal and resin for the case, with backlit action buttons . The wireless controller can be used upto 30ft away from the console and has full six direction tilt action.

Nyko Zero Wireless PS2 Controller

 

Nyko claims “up to 25 hours of play time” on a single charge, the Vibration feedback can be disabled to provide a longer battery life.

Available for $49 about £26

Move Over Apple TV - Here Comes Archos TV+

January 4, 2008 at 5:17 pm

Archos have announced Archos TV+, a new digital PVR.

archos tv+

The Archos TV+ is a WiFi digital video recorder, an comes in either a 80GB or a 250GB version.

It will stream content direct from your PC or PMP and also download content from the Archos Content channel.

It also features a built in web browser and email support.

The 80GB version will retail for $229 and the 250GB version will retail for $349.

This is going to be serious competition for Apple TV, as the Archos TV+ will have no restriction on the types of media files you can play through it.

New Mini Desktop PC - The LLUON Crystal

December 28, 2007 at 3:59 pm

Korean company Trigem Computer, has released a new mini desktop PC the LLUON Crystal.

LLUON Crystal

Two versions of this mini PC are available.

LLUON Crystal

The first model is the LBFC27-RIBO, which features an Intel Core 2 Duo T5200 processor (1.66GHz), 1GB of RAM, a 320GB HDD and a GeForce 8400 GS graphics card.

LLUON Crystal

The second model is the LCFVC35-RIBO, which features an Intel Core 2 Duo T5200 processor (2.00GHz), 2GB of RAM, a 500GB HDD and a GeForce 8400 GS graphics card, it also features built in WiFi.

The LBFC27-RIBO will retail for about $1300 (about £650) and the LCFVC35-RIBO will retail for about $1500 (about £750).

VOIP on the iPod Touch, maybe on the iPhone Soon

December 11, 2007 at 11:00 am

Some clever coder has managed to get a VOIP application running on the iPod Touch.

voip ipod

The VOIP application used is one for the Nintendo DS, the software used was Samuel’s SvSIP.

SvSIP uses the SIP protocol to connect to other participants and to allow you to talk over WiFi, this is pretty cool and it will be interesting to see how this develops, who knows we may have a fully working VOIP app on the iPhone sometime soon.
